Output 675adb7d325d656b6a1bf3a057dd3b3d612403ff634ae3891f32d489674441e0:0

value
150900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8e494e2720b34f8551f38959d222cee87e63648 OP_EQUAL
address
3JYe5y3rNzcHRjGgyEfsdoBRGajYi8CiSD
transaction
675adb7d325d656b6a1bf3a057dd3b3d612403ff634ae3891f32d489674441e0
confirmations
225326
spent
true